Unity shader graph plugin

In the past, the only way to create shaders was just coding. Shadow distance quality setting. Possible to include the Unity Accessibility Plugin for the development of accessible mobile apps. Organic looks, fancy dissolves or liquid surfaces. 1 brought new levels of control and flexibility, and introduced Shader Graph. Feb 19, 2020 · On the other hand, Shader Graph hides all these shader stages make it easy to develop shaders. ] stelabouras Unity GPU Optimization: Is Your Game. Hologram Shader Today’s project is Lightning effects with Shader Graph and VFX Graph. Today’s project is Lightning effects with Shader Graph and VFX Graph. Hit enter to search or ESC to close. Shader Graph Post Processing? Question Hi unity people, I've been dipping my feet into shader territory for the first time while working on my current project, and I'm trying to create a shader to swap the colour palette for the entire screen depending on the room the player is in (It's a 2D game if that's relevant). Use the global setter methods of the shader like Shader. In this live training session we will learn the fundamentals of authoring shaders for Unity and you will learn how to write your very first shader. Unity Shader Graph - Ice Shader - Project. Add a plane on your scene with the material mat_WaterShader. If you do, then let’s get to work! Shader Graph Extensions Custom nodes for Unity Shader Graph . This scene does not use any textures or animation assets; everything you see is colored and animated using Shader Graph. Those looks can be achieved by shader UV distortion. ShaderGraph Essentials adds unique must-have features to ShaderGraph: - 30+ noises node. Shader graph is a superb tool to create high quality, PBR or Unlit Shaders. These tutorials start from the beginning and our aim is to give you the basic knowledge to create your own shaders. - generate a texture from any node in the graph (in editor) - 3 additionnal master nodes (Unlit, SimpleLit, Toon) with more parameters. It contains Ice Shaders, Textures and Crystals. In this tutorial, you’re going to create your first shader graph in Unity right now! Getting Started. Unity Shader Graph 구현hlsl 코드를 분석해서 Shader graph로 재구현 Oct 26, 2018 · With Shader Graph in Unity 2018, creating powerful and beautiful shaders has never been easier. ), time, world and local positioning, plenty of math operations, texture sampling, and the list goes on and on. This includes the changes from Master Node to Master Stack and how to upgrade. Add depth to your next project with 2D Glowy Dissolve Shader Graph from BinaryLunar. This is the same for vertices also. Shader Unity Support. lv To install Shader Graph, either create or update a Project to version 2018. Each pixel stores the height difference perpendicular to the face that pixel represents. in order to set the Spec Brightness you would do Aug 05, 2020 · Importing HLSL into Shader Graph. Most indie game developers omit it up to an advanced level. ), time, world I hope you enjoyed this tutorial! If you have any questions, comments or suggestions, feel free to leave them in the comments below or to visit our forums. These unity shader graph glitch effect between the surface normal and the view direction the effect, you need to implement a custom processing Graph open and a graph built, it must be either URP or HDRP am I that! It would be to edit Postprocessing stack effects in Shader graph for Unity want is possible see if what want Apr 24, 2020 · Daniel Santalla Unity Shader Graph viewer - This simple tool allows you to open and preview any . First, you'll discover how to develop shaders through the Shader Graph for both materials and effects. . See in Glossary as a normal map, the process is almost identical, except you need to check the â Create from Greyscaleâ option. Now that we have some HLSL code which satisfies Shader Graph’s requirements we’re able to import this code into a Custom Function node and write it up as we would any other node. Unity 2018. So recreating the hand-coded shader using shader graph Unity Graphics - Including Scriptable Render Pipeline - Unity-Technologies/Graphics Sep 21, 2019 · Shader Graph in Unity 2019 lets you easily create shaders by building them visually and see the results in real time. Right-click in the Project window and from the Create flyout, navigate to Shader and select Unlit Graph. You had to learn how to write shader code and also need mathematical skills. io/bolt/downloadThe time has come Let's explore Unity's new Shader Graph!♥ Support Brackeys on Patreon: http://patreon. Tags:Shaders fire-wave Dissolve Shader Graph Made with Unity Report Jun 13, 2020 · Over the last few years, visual shader editors such as Unity’s Shader Graph have started to alleviate that pain point by simplifying the process of implementing hundreds of common shader routines in a node-based editor. To create a Shader Graph Asset you click the create menu in the Project Window and select Shader from the dropdown. Water Shader. The non-cel shaded objects are using the standard Lit shader for comparison. Introduction to Shader Graph: Build your shaders with a visual editor. e. I am going to show you how this is done with the example of a simple caustics projector effect, like this: This is a projector, projecting a distorted map onto the geometry. In this Shader Graph tutorial we are going to see how to create a n awesome Fire and Flame Shader in Unity! Useful for Campfires, Torches, Candles or even a lighter. Dec 03, 2019 · F ew years back, I wrote a simple cross section shader in unity using Surface shader, unfortunately that shader didn’t support different kind of maps (i. Save up to 96% on Lunar New Year Mega Bundles! Dec 25, 2018 · Since Unity announced Shader Graph editor available as an optional package starting version 2018. The material applied to all objects in the scene is an opaque lit shader which is driven by a shader graph. Dissolve Shader. Tutorials how to create dissolve and fire-waves shaders. shadersubgraph file generated by Unity's shader graph locally. SetGlobalXY. Contribute to Unity-Technologies/ShaderGraph development by creating an account on GitHub. The Unity plugin is compatible with Unity’s HDRP, URP and legacy renderers (some rendering features are only compatible with HDRP) however it is currently difficult to maintain our Shader graph and HDRP/URP integrations across Unity versions, due to missing API entry points. An open and tightly integrated solution, it provides a familiar and consistent development environment that seamlessly blends with Unity’s UI conventions and Shader use. Documentation Explore this comprehensive resource for the Unity Editor Search it or browse it – the Unity User Manual is the definitive repository for in-depth and procedural information on all of Unity’s features, UI, and workflows. Firstly, select ‘Create > Shader > Unlit Shader’ in the Project window to create an Unlit shader file. These unity shader graph glitch effect between the surface normal and the view direction the effect, you need to implement a custom processing Graph open and a graph built, it must be either URP or HDRP am I that! It would be to edit Postprocessing stack effects in Shader graph for Unity want is possible see if what want The PBR Graph allows us to create a new shader that takes inputs from Unity’s Physically Based Rendering system,so that our shader can use features such as shadows and reflections. This video shows the differences between original and enhanced versions. The jump in the… . Let’s start by creating or opening a Shader Graph file and adding a Custom Function node. If you are looking for any info about how to make a pixelated effect on any sprite in Unity, look no further. Save up to 96% on Lunar New Year Mega Bundles! The other day I made a simple pixelated shader with Unity Shader Graph. 中文说明移步 >> README_CH. Syntax Highligt. "Ball Twister" for Android is my first game (or demo) that is using LWRP and shader graphs AND is available for public. Combined with a simple glow effect, you can make the dissolving process look very futuristic - today, we’re going to leverage the power of Shader Graph to make it happen. But modeling a complex formula or algorithm using the standard graph nodes is going to be a daunting task. 1, a Shader Graph appears as a normal shader. Download ShaderGraph Essentials from the Unity Asset Store ! TLDR. This editor is much quicker than manually stringing Creating shaders with features that behave differently on certain platforms. In this course, Introduction to Shader Graph in Unity, you'll explore the Unity Shader Graph. Jun 25, 2019 · Tagged: Game Engine, tutorial, unity, unity 2019, unity easy, unity portal, unity portals, unity shader tutorial, Unity Technologies, unity teleport tutorial With: 0 Comments Learn how to create a portal effect in Unity’s Lightweight Render Pipeline and Shader Graph. No prior knowledge of authoring shaders is required. This intermediate-level session will explore best practices for rendering performance and shader creation workflow. To use Shader Graph in Unity, you have to have a project which uses Universal or High Definition Render Pipeline. If your materials are not animating in the Scene view, make sure you have Animated Materials checked: Sep 03, 2020 · For the . I’ll show you how you can do that using Unity Shader Graph. Read more. The other day I made a simple pixelated shader with Unity Shader Graph. In some applications however, it would be more sensible to use a transparent unlit shader and overlay it on top of the existing rendering via an additional rendering step Nov 21, 2019 · Unity Shader Graph – Flames / Fire Effect Shader Tutorial. Oct 12, 2020 · In the Project window, create a new folder named “Shader Graph”. That was a great start to make something new with that knowledge. Code Completions. Amplify Shader Editor (ASE) is a node-based shader creation tool inspired by industry leading software. 2, which make it much easier to create graphs that work in both the Universal Render Pipeline (URP) and the High Definition Render Pipeline (HDRP). unity shaders transparency dither urp shadergraph Updated Apr 19, 2020 Find this & more VFX Shaders on the Unity Asset Store. You create and connect nodes in a network graph instead of having to write code. com Sphere reveal Shader Graph, instructions in comments - Unity3D reddit. Verify the asset saved by clicking on the shader and looking in the inspector. It is found in Graph Inspector -> Node Settings. Oct 3, 2020 - Explore mehdi's board "Unity shader Graph Tutorial", followed by 189 people on Pinterest. Shader Graph Feb 27, 2018 · In Unity 2018. fbx mesh Unity doesn’t have to convert the units so make sure Convert Units is unchecked in the import settings. You can now drag and drop all kinds of nodes including noise generation, logical operators (AND, OR, NOT, etc. In Unity 2018. May 25, 2018 · Unity ShaderGraph project. com/ Nov 20, 2019 · Shader Graph Tutorials for Unity3D Developers. Apr 13, 2020 · The reason is that the texture was generated in a native android plugin using OpenGL. After a quick review on the types of shaders and understanding the basics of Shadergraph and exploring the user interface we move on to create our first graph which is a TV Flicker effect. Now it’s time to get to the meat of Unity shader graph scripting. I have started using new Unity render pipelines in my ongoing game projects. With Unity’s Visual Effect Graph, you can add a Shader Graph file to any of the Output Contexts, provided that the active master node in the Shader Graph is a Visual Effects node. Often in games, especially with pixel art, they have this cool pixelated ground. From here you can create either a PBR or Unlit Shader Graph Asset. Hence, you do not need to worry about the graphics rendering pipeline much. [The source code is also available. Shader development was not so easy in the past. com The Shader Approach to Billboarding 80. etc. Based on its type, Unity defines a Keyword in the graph, shader, and optionally, the Material Inspector. This procedurally generated lightning is done with Shader Graph and then we create a few particle effects with VFX Graph. Apr 18, 2020 · As seen in the last article, it is quite handy to create shaders using a shader graph. For times when you need to split a See full list on blogs. Aug 04, 2020 · Unity Shader Graph *Important Resources* Important and useful links to Unity Shader Graph tutorials, custom nodes, examples and other resources. md There is a README. Shader Graph Updates and Sample Project - Unity Technologies Blog blogs. Create Unlit Shader. But today this is changed with shader graph. Because Shader Graph doesn’t have a three-dimensional noise node by default this shader uses custom Simplex3D and later Cellular3D noise nodes. See more ideas about unity, graphing, tutorial. Creating shaders with features that behave differently on certain platforms. ---HOW TO INSTALL AND SET UP SHADER GRAPH IN UNITY 2018---In this video I show you how to set up and install shader graph for use in Unity 2018. To create a Shader Graph you click the Create menu, and select ‘Shader Graph’ from the dropdown. Click the little cogwheel in the top Dec 04, 2019 · Unity introduced Shader Graph to allow you to more easlily write shaders, with minimal to no coding. Dec 19, 2020 · We will now familiarize ourselves with the use of custom function nodes in shader graph to obtain a greater level of control over our shaders. In Unity a Shader Graph Asset appears as a normal shader. 2 or above, navigate to Window > Package Manager > All, find Shader Graphin the list and click install. Custom Nodes. ), This week I got a task to visualize human heart with the above effect in which we need to apply color, normal and metallic maps on the heart model. You can also retrieve it using Shader. Unity Shader Graph viewer This viewer allows you to open any . subshadergraph files to the library or even send encrypted preview links to your peers. A dither transparency shader for Unity's Shader Graph and Universal Render Pipeline. g. Shaders made with ShaderGraph from various tutorials. shadergraph and . This will create a Shader Graph asset in the project. Shaders are an incredibly powerful aspect This is not only a course on shader graph, this is also an introduction to shader development. e. PropertyToID. subshadergraph files to the library. This will create a Shader Graph Asset in the project. Sep 11, 2020 · The clip below was put together pretty quickly using Unity’s built in timeline editor along with a custom Unity Shader Graph download. Main Functions. Shader Graph File, material and plane. There are three types of Keyword: Boolean, Enum, and Built-in. A new Shader Graph will be generated in the Project window. shader grammer, see beautify_unity Port shader graph to ShaderLab. This tool supports shader programming in Cg for Unity. Code Format ( achieved by a parser speci for . Sep 22, 2020 · For an example of how you’d use this further, see Unity’s article on custom lighting here. Affordable quality and flexibility with the responsive customer support you can expect from Amplify Creations. Normally, shader development is not easy but the shader graph makes it easier and intuitive. Shader Graph is designed to work with the Scriptable Render Pipelines (SRPs), namely the Universal Render Pipeline (formerly the Lightweight Render Pipeline or LWRP) and the High Definition Render Pipeline (HDRP). Dec 19, 2020 · In this tutorial, we will create a scanning effect which radiates from the camera outwards onto the nearby geometry. 2. unity3d. Whether you’re a beginner or a pro, it helps you create a range of shaders – flowing lava, gooey slime, beautiful lakes, flashing LEDs, and more. Find this & other Tools options on the Unity Asset Store. Next, we create a Unity project with the URP Template and use this as a building block to learn more about unity’s shader types. Shader-Graph-Examples. Grass Shader. Under Properties it should list _MainTex. This will require us to write some HLSL code, but Unity makes this easy. 1 I had mixed feelings about that. Use the generated shader property ID you can find in the Inspector of the shader asset itself. Built with Unity 2019. In the Project Windows, create a new Shader Graph : Right click then Create -> Shader -> PBR Graph. A perfect way to simulate caustics for example. 1 or newer. It contains code completion mechanic and enables C/C++ highlighting style. (Figure 01) Figure 01: The Unlit Graph setting in the Shader flyout. The code of the created shader is shown below. Next, let’s port this shader graph to ShaderLab. Is it really such a big deal? Is it that hard to grasp some knowledge about basic shader functions and create own, using CG code? Check out Bolt: http://ludiq. Get access to many more Shaders and VFX packages: ———————————————————————-. 5K Race; Who We Are; Get Involved; Contact Us; Donate; Uncategorized unity translucent shader graph Join us for a demo of the new Shader Graph updates in Unity 2020. Next, you'll get an introduction to a few technical concepts necessary for achieving mastery in shader writing. Creating shaders that scale in complexity based on various conditions. But with great power, comes great responsibility. Once it’s ported to ShaderLab, you can upload it to STYLY. You can double click on the asset or select the Open Graph button to bring up the Shader Graph Edit window. If you’re new to Shader Graph you can read Tim Cooper’s blog post to learn about the main features or watch Andy Touch’s “Shader Graph Introduction” talk on the Unity YouTube channel. This will make the logic a little less janky, clean up our graph a lot and we’ll get to add some visual improvements to this shader. NEW Aug 10, 2018 · Unity Shader Graph scripting in action Unity Shader Graph Scripting. When you set properties to be exposed in Shader Graph, you can access and change the values per particle inside of your Visual Effect Graph. (I’ll write a similar thing here in the future) The other two keywords work fine if defined in Shader Graph, and will also be set automatically by URP as long as they are Multi Compile & Global. You can do things like: A sublime text plugin which aim at boosting happiness when editing Unity Shader, behaved as IDE-like, followed the lastest Unity release. md copied in Chinese. 2. Vertex shaders are executed in parallel for each vertex. You can also change it to match your actual parameter name. been achieved by creating a shader graph in unity. We also show you how to use the new Graph Inspector and the Master Stack output, and discuss project upgrade considerations. Name it like WaterShader; Create the material by clicking on the file WaterShader and name it mat_WaterShader. Watch the video on YouTube and learn more about Shader Graph on the Unity website. You can also submit your . Feb 08, 2021 · Unity Technologies has released a video outlining the new features available in Shader Graph implemented in version 2020. com Get the Planet Shader Graph HDRP package from Koza and speed up your game development process. shadersubgraph file generated by Unity's shader graph. Jun 13, 2020 · Over the last few years, visual shader editors such as Unity’s Shader Graph have started to alleviate that pain point by simplifying the process of implementing hundreds of common shader routines in a node-based editor. This tutorial uses Unity version 2019. I have not yet implemented additional light support, and I am still fine-tweaking the light response at various roughness levels (this is a non-metal at ~20% roughness or 80% smoothness, depending which term you prefer). Shader Graph has also been used in the latest Unity demos – the FPS Sample and The Heretic. As we mentioned in our previous tutorials, shaders work simultaneously for each pixel. Best of all, Shader Graph makes it easy to get started with a visual, interactive interface. Let’s break this code down line-by-line – 5 references the outfit material as serialized field, which means it be can set directly from the editor. normal map, height map. Here's the whole project created for the Ice Shader video tutorial. (usually in the top right of the ShaderGraph) Be sure to change "Texture2D_234E865" to "_MainTex" there.